As QA Process Leader you’ll be working as part of the Technical Department, verifying and validating legal compliance in food manufacturing and customer specifications within the Added Value site. To ensure product safety / quality / legality through effective HACCP, Food Defence and Quality System and adherence to customer specifications and requirements. Undertake audits of our processes and procedures to ensure the site maintains certification and accreditation with all relevant licensing bodies and retailers. Support, where appropriate, the technical management team in preparation for and during third party audits and customer visits. So you’ll be working in a fast-paced, dynamic FMCG factory environment which is noisy and refrigerated in some areas, manufacturing short shelf life products where hygiene standards are critical.
Job Responsibility:
Lead the Quality Auditors to always operate in a safe manner
Delivering training of technical task procedures to colleagues and completing competency assessments where needed
Monitor and review QA’s weekly task list and ensure good communication between all shifts
Monitor and audit Production Operations to ensure that customer requirements are understood and achieved
Managing the NC’s log for products on hold, ensuring the release, rework, repack and disposal of products in a timely manner, liaising with planning, production and despatch
Inspecting product against customer quality contract agreements
GMP Audits – conduct against a scheduled frequency to ensure good manufacturing practice at site
Complete required audits such as hygiene audits, glass & plastics, fabrication audits and CCP audits in line with site procedures
Ensure all paperwork is completed in full, in line with company procedures and legal requirements
Carry out verification checks of calibration of measuring equipment in accordance with the schedule
Carry out swabbing verification
Support the Supply Chain Coordinator with Traceability in accordance with the scheduled frequency and as required
Working with and supporting the technical coordinators with a full understanding of SI product data base, Clearview, checkweighers etc
Maintenance of new Micro sampling programme and shelf-life testing
Support the delivery of the Wednesbury Quality Objectives and Food Safety Culture
HACCP and Food Defence team member
Support filing of record documents and archiving
